In a security setting, where stakes are high, establishing clear lines of communication isn’t just smart; it’s essential.

Furthermore, strong communication fosters relationships not just among team members, but with the public as well. Building trust is crucial, especially in security roles that often put guards on the front lines of community interaction. By engaging clearly with the public, security personnel can create a sense of safety and openness. This proactive communication not only bolsters public confidence but also enhances the effectiveness of security operations overall.

But let’s dig a bit deeper. In emergency situations, how crucial is communication? In a crisis, the ability to relay and receive information swiftly can make all the difference. Think about it: if guards can quickly communicate a threat or suspicious activity, they can respond more effectively. They may call for backup or inform the necessary authorities, potentially averting disaster. This swift flow of information allows for cohesive actions that can successfully manage or diffuse tense situations.
